Sauce (adapted from Isa Does It): 1/2 cup
peanut butter 2 cloves of garlic (peeled duh) 1 tsp fresh grated ginger 1/2 cup water 3 Tablespoons lime juice 2 Tablespoons tamari or soy sauce 1 Tablespoon liquid sweetener (agave,
maple syrup, whatever) 1 Tablespoon sriracha 1/2 teaspoon salt or to
taste

Recipe: — 4 - 5 tablespoons natural
peanut butter avoid the kind with palm oil — Juice of 1 lime — 1 clove garlic — 1 tablespoon (sweet) soy sauce — 1 tablespoon tamarind paste — 1 tablespoon raw agave syrup (or
maple syrup)-- Hot sauce / sambal or fresh chili peppers to
taste — 4 tablespoons of water and / or cocunutmilk
